    You can also purchase food from local takeaway, they normally work out to around Rs50 for a large meal. This is what me and my husband do every time we visit, all local takeaways have a menu outside. When you walk in simply tell the local what you want to order and they will get if from the kitchen or serve you through a visible buffet.

    Great tips!! As a local I’d just advise everyone to not go swimming at anse intendance , Grande Anse -Mahe & Grande Anse -La Digue. (Especially if you’re not a very good swimmer).They are super beautiful but equally dangerous. The waves & currents are strong.

    I live and work here in Seychelles. And I can tell you that this is the most expensive country I have ever lived in. Everything is just expensive. And when I mean expensive, I mean 3-4 times of the price you can get same products and services elsewhere. And one of the reasons behind the expensiveness of this country is because they import almost everything.
